In Brightspace, you can add Library Guides under Content, such as literature reviews, databases, guides for literature research, the use of APA guidelines, or the library catalog. The library ensures that this information remains up to date.
To add (content from) Library Guides, go to the course where this information should be placed.
Click on Content in the navbar, then click on the location where you want to add the Library Guides. Click Add Existing.
In the next screen, choose External Tool Activity.
Then, select HanzeMediatheek - Library Guides.
The HanzeMediatheek - Library Guides will be added to your Content. Next, choose the Content Type, Guide, and optionally the Guide Page you want to add. To add the Guide, click Embed Content.
For a specific A-Z database, it's better to add a link to the database page in the A-Z list. A guide on how to do this is provided below.
Search for the database in the A-Z Databases lijst and click on the name.
Copy the URL of the database page. This name always starts with https://libguides.hanze.nl/az, for example https://libguides.hanze.nl/az/van-dale-online-dictionaries
Click on Create New in the unit, then select Web Link.
- Enter the name of the database in the Web Link Title.
- Paste the URL of the database in the Link field.
- You can choose to open the page in a new tab or embed it.
- Don't forget to make the link visible.
- Click on Save and Close
The link will appear in the Content of the course.
